Output 8907b3b20214c611749331518cb2524a7c863a485da82ce5d29c5055eff95e18:2

value
6604825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c35da8a31e3c2d631eb4f2472fde3485991983d9 OP_EQUALVERIFY OP_CHECKSIG
address
1JozxvxCPKFkdP4itHj8NorWJXnjrkw5Un
transaction
8907b3b20214c611749331518cb2524a7c863a485da82ce5d29c5055eff95e18
spent
true